Zhang Ruyi1 collaborationZhang questions everything. Her intuitive mixed-media practice juxtaposes materials to reframe ideas of everyday life. Exploring the relationship between personal identity and the urban landscape, her central motif – cacti – functions as an unlikely self-portrait. Meditating on the effects of rapid urbanisation, Zhang creates subversive, and quietly surreal interior displays in concrete. By hand-casting cement with a mould, Zhang enshrines the quintessential construction material in plant form. She also uses ceramic grid tiles, an architectural pattern that frequently features in Chinese urban neighbourhoods, and originally inspired by the patterning of Dutch painter Piet Mondrian – its repetition tranquil and harmonising.
